Heres a post from the Kubuntu forums and here's also how it was solved:
the problem :
just installed cinelerra .deb with GDebi Package Installer from their
website, only where did it install to and how can I open it? it isn't in the
start menu... [image: Huh]
Thanks
How i fixed the user issue:
OK now hold on a lot of information is in this poseted as i tried the deb
package too all it does it add something in the back ground.
*Step 1. *
open terminal and paste this :
wget -q http://akirad.cinelerra.org/pool/addakirad.deb && sudo dpkg -i
addakirad.deb && rm addakirad.deb && sudo apt-get update
it will then ask you for your root pw (likley same as login pw)
[sudo] password for user:
then a lot of stuff will fly by in the terminal screen
*Step 2: *
usern...@pcnamenix:~$ sudo apt-get update
More fly by stuff then
*
Step 3:*
usern...@pcnamenix:~$ sudo apt-get install cinelerra
(then this stuff will appear)
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
The following extra packages will be installed:
akiradnews cinelerracv liba52-0.7.4 libavcodec51 libavutil49 libfaad0
libgsm1 libguicastcv libmjpegtools0c2a libmpeg3cv libquicktime1
libquicktimecv libswscale0 optlibx11-noxcb-6 optlibx11-noxcb-data
The following NEW packages will be installed:
akiradnews cinelerra cinelerracv liba52-0.7.4 libavcodec51 libavutil49
libfaad0 libgsm1 libguicastcv libmjpegtools0c2a libmpeg3cv libquicktime1
libquicktimecv libswscale0 optlibx11-noxcb-6 optlibx11-noxcb-data
0 upgraded, 16 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.
Need to get 18.7MB of archives.
After this operation, 42.9MB of additional disk space will be used.
Do you want to continue [Y/n]? y
(say Y)
then a lot of stuff will be flying by
and then
Setting up cinelerra (1:2.1.0-1svn20081017akirad2) ...
Processing triggers for libc6 ...
ldconfig deferred processing now taking place
usern...@pcnamenix:~$
*
Step 4 check multimedia menu Sweet its installed !!!*
this got it to work for me the debian package did not install the package
under kubuntu
